勵志

勵志人生知識庫

語音編碼是什麼

語音編碼是一種將模擬語音信號轉換成數字形式的技術,目的是爲了將語音數字化,並利用人的發聲過程中存在的冗餘度和人的聽覺特性來降低編碼率,從而更高效地存儲、傳輸和恢復語音信號。

在編碼過程中,語音信號首先被採樣和量化,然後轉換成數字數據流。這些數字數據可以更容易地在數字設備之間傳輸或存儲。語音編碼技術基於人耳對聲音的感知機制,利用信號處理數學算法來提取和表示語音信號中的重要特徵,如語音的頻譜內容時域特性聲學參數等。

語音編碼的基本方法包括波形編碼參量編碼(也稱爲音源編碼)和混合編碼。波形編碼專注於盡可能精確地再現原始語音波形,而參量編碼則是基於人類語言的發音機理來找出表徵語音的特徵參量並進行編碼。混合編碼則結合了波形編碼和參量編碼的優點,可以在較低的碼速率下保持較高的語音質量。

此外,語音編碼還涉及到信源編碼,其目的是在編碼端儘可能地壓縮要傳遞的信息的數據量,同時在解碼端能夠無損(或接近無損)地恢復出原始信息。例如,一些現代的語音編解碼器可以實現高達10倍以上的壓縮率,這大大降低了傳遞信息所需消耗的帶寬資源。